About

The Rotary Guernsey Walk Trust is a registered charity, Guernsey Registry number CH191, constituted by a trust deed. It comprises members from Rotary Club of Guernsey and Rotary Guernesiais. The trust organises the annual Rotary Round Guernsey Walk, currently branded the Saffery Rotary Walk, which includes a 39-mile coastal route, relay teams, a Family Walk, and a Step By Step Walk. The event raises funds that are distributed as grants to Bailiwick charities. Simon Milsted is the Walk Chairman.
